/**
* The Application class forms the foundation for most Lime projects.
* It is common to extend this class in a main class. It is then possible
* to override "on" functions in the class in order to handle standard events
* that are relevant.
*/
class Application extends Module {
/**
* Update events are dispatched each frame (usually just before rendering)
*/
public static var onUpdate = new Event<Int->Void> ();

/**
* Adds a new Window to the Application. By default, this is
* called automatically by create()
* @param window A Window object to add
*/
public function addWindow (window:Window):Void {
windows.push (window);
@@ -61,6 +75,12 @@ class Application extends Module {
}
/**
* Initializes the Application, using the settings defined in
* the config instance. By default, this is called automatically
* when building the project using Aether
* @param config A Config object
*/
public function create (config:Config):Void {
this.config = config;
@@ -108,6 +128,12 @@ class Application extends Module {
}
/**
* Execute the Application. On native platforms, this method
* blocks until the application is finished running. On other
* platforms, it will return immediately
* @return An exit code, 0 if there was no error
*/
public function exec ():Int {
#if (cpp || neko)
@@ -160,6 +186,12 @@ class Application extends Module {
}
/**
* The init() method is called once before the first render()
* call. This can be used to do initial set-up for the current
* render context
* @param context The current render context
*/
public function init (context:RenderContext):Void {
